轻松入门Go语从安装到运行_根据你的操作系统_可以从简单的项目开始逐渐挑战更复杂的项目
一、轻松入门Go语言:从安装到运行
1. 安装Go语言环境
在开始编写和运行Go代码之前,你需要在电脑上安装Go语言开发环境。这就像给电脑装上Go语言的“操作系统”。
1.1 下载Go安装包
访问Go语言官方网站,根据你的操作系统(Windows、macOS或Linux)选择相应的安装包下载。
1.2 安装Go语言
不同的操作系统安装方式不同:
操作系统 | 安装方法 |
---|---|
Windows | 双击下载的安装包,按照提示完成安装。 |
macOS | 双击下载的.pkg文件,按照提示完成安装。 |
Linux | 使用包管理工具(如apt或yum)安装,或者手动下载压缩包进行安装。 |
1.3 配置环境变量
安装完成后,需要将Go的安装目录添加到系统的环境变量中。以Windows为例,可以在系统设置中添加和变量,并将Go的安装目录添加到变量中。
1.4 验证安装
打开命令行工具(如cmd或Terminal),输入`go version`,如果显示Go的版本信息,说明安装成功。
2. 编写Go代码
安装完成Go语言环境后,就可以开始编写Go代码了。以下是一个简单的Go程序示例:
```go package main import "fmt" func main() { fmt.Println("Hello, World!") } ```3. 编译Go代码
编写完成代码后,需要将其编译成可执行文件。以下是编译Go代码的步骤:
3.1 打开命令行工具
在Windows中,可以使用cmd或PowerShell;在macOS和Linux中,可以使用Terminal。
3.2 导航到工作目录
使用命令导航到存放Go代码的工作目录。例如:
``` cd Desktop/GoProjects ```3.3 编译代码
使用命令编译代码文件。例如:
``` go build ```3.4 生成可执行文件
编译完成后,工作目录中会生成一个可执行文件。在Windows中,文件名为`hello.exe`;在macOS和Linux中,文件名为`hello`。
4. 运行编译后的程序
编译完成后,可以运行生成的可执行文件。以下是运行可执行文件的步骤:
4.1 在命令行工具中运行程序
在Windows中,输入以下命令:
``` ./hello.exe ```在macOS和Linux中,输入以下命令:
``` ./hello ```4.2 查看输出
运行程序后,命令行工具中会显示输出,说明程序运行成功。
5. 常见问题和解决方法
在运行Go代码的过程中,可能会遇到一些常见的问题。以下是一些常见问题及其解决方法:
5.1 环境变量配置问题
如果在命令行工具中输入`go version`后提示找不到命令,可能是环境变量配置有误。需要检查和变量是否正确配置,并确保Go的安装目录添加到变量中。
5.2 编译错误
如果在编译代码时出现错误,需要检查代码文件中的语法是否正确。例如,漏掉了导入包或函数定义中的括号。
5.3 运行时错误
如果在运行可执行文件时出现错误,需要检查代码逻辑是否正确。例如,函数调用是否正确,是否有未处理的错误等。
6. 总结和建议
你已经学会了如何在Go语言中安装环境、编写代码、编译和运行程序。以下是一些建议,帮助你更好地掌握Go语言:
6.1 深入学习Go语言语法
可以通过阅读官方文档或参考书籍,系统地学习Go语言的语法和特性。
6.2 实践项目
通过实际项目练习,提高编写和调试代码的能力。可以从简单的项目开始,逐渐挑战更复杂的项目。
6.3 参与社区
加入Go语言社区,与其他开发者交流经验和问题。可以通过参加会议、加入在线论坛或贡献开源项目等方式参与社区活动。
通过不断学习和实践,你将逐渐掌握Go语言的使用技巧,成为一名优秀的Go语言开发者。